Flavorful Chickpea Mixture

The chickpea mixture is the star of these wraps, providing a creamy texture that pairs perfectly with the other ingredients. Mashing the chickpeas partially allows for a hearty bite, while the avocado contributes healthy fats and adds richness. Be sure to season the mixture well with cumin, salt, and pepper, as these spices enhance the overall flavor. Adjust the cumin to your liking; a bit more can provide a deeper earthy note that balances beautifully with the freshness of the veggies.

Using a fork or potato masher creates the right consistency in the chickpeas—smooth yet chunky. This adds depth and bite to the wraps. If you prefer a spicier kick, consider adding a dash of cayenne pepper or a squeeze of lime juice for added zest. Remember to taste the mixture as you go, as this will help you adjust the seasonings to your preference before assembling the wraps.

Customizing Your Wraps

One of the best aspects of these chickpea wraps is their versatility. Feel free to swap out the spinach for other greens like arugula or kale, which can provide different flavor profiles and textures. Adding shredded carrots or cucumber will introduce a nice crunch, while sliced bell peppers can contribute sweetness. The fresh ingredients can be tailored to the season, ensuring your lunch remains vibrant and interesting all year round.

For those avoiding gluten, these wraps can easily be made using gluten-free tortillas or lettuce leaves. I personally enjoy experimenting with different herb combinations; fresh cilantro or parsley can add a refreshing twist. Additionally, you might want to drizzle a homemade dressing, such as tahini or a yogurt-based sauce, inside the wrap for extra flavor and moisture.

Meal Prep and Storage Tips

These Healthy Lunch Chickpea Wraps are ideal for meal prepping! You can prepare the chickpea mixture a day ahead and store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ator. This not only saves time during busy weekdays but also allows the flavors to meld together, enhancing the overall taste. When ready to assemble, just spread it on a tortilla along with your choice of fresh vegetables; the assembly takes less than 5 minutes.

If you want to make these wraps in bulk, they hold up well for about 24 hours in the fridge, though the tortillas may soften slightly. To enjoy them during your workweek, consider wrapping them tightly in foil or parchment paper after slicing, as this helps maintain their shape and prevents them from getting soggy. If you want to freeze the wraps, it's best to wrap the fillings separately, as freezing can affect the texture of the fresh vegetables.

Ingredients

Gather your ingredients for the wraps:

Wrap Ingredients

  • 1 can chickpeas, drained and rinsed
  • 1 avocado, mashed
  • 1 cup spinach leaves
  • 1/2 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 1/4 cup red onion, finely chopped
  • 1 teaspoon cumin
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 4 whole grain tortillas

Now that you have your ingredients, you are ready to assemble!

Instructions

Follow these simple steps to create your wraps:

Prepare the Chickpea Mixture

In a bowl, mash the chickpeas with a fork or potato masher until partially mashed but still chunky. Stir in the mashed avocado, cumin, salt, and pepper until well combined.

Assemble the Wraps

Lay a tortilla flat and spread a generous amount of the chickpea mixture in the center. Top with spinach leaves, cherry tomatoes, and red onion.

Wrap It Up

Fold the sides of the tortilla over the filling and roll it up tightly, ensuring all the filling is secured inside.

Slice and Serve

Cut the wraps in half and serve them immediately or wrap them in foil for on-the-go lunches.

Ingredient Spotlight: Chickpeas

Chickpeas are packed with protein, fiber, and essential vitamins and minerals, making them a fantastic addition to any diet. They have a mild, nutty flavor and a creamy texture that makes them incredibly versatile. In this recipe, chickpeas not only provide a hearty base but also contribute to the nutritional profile, keeping you satiated and energized. They’re also a great source of plant-based protein for those looking to reduce meat consumption.

When selecting chickpeas for this recipe, consider using canned chickpeas for convenience. However, if you prefer to use dried chickpeas, you can soak and cook them ahead of time. Just remember that soaking overnight can reduce the cooking time, and cooked chickpeas can be stored in the refrigerator for up to a week, making meal prep a breeze.

Troubleshooting Tips

If you find that your chickpea mixture is too dry, simply add a bit more mashed avocado or a splash of lemon juice to keep it creamy and moist. Conversely, if the mixture is too wet, make sure to drain chickpeas thoroughly and consider adding a tablespoon of oats or ground flaxseed to absorb excess moisture without affecting the flavor.

Another common issue is the tortillas breaking or tearing while rolling. Gently warming the tortillas in a dry skillet or microwave for a few seconds can make them more pliable and easier to wrap. If you encounter any leftover filling, store it separately and enjoy it as a salad topping or in a grain bowl for a quick snack.

Questions About Recipes

→ Can I make these wraps ahead of time?

Yes, you can prepare the chickpea mixture the night before. Just assemble the wraps right before you plan to eat them for the freshest taste.

→ What can I use instead of chickpeas?

You can substitute chickpeas with other legumes like black beans or lentils. Just ensure they are cooked and seasoned adequately.

→ Are these wraps vegan?

Absolutely! This recipe is entirely plant-based, making it suitable for vegans and vegetarians.

→ How can I store leftovers?

Store any leftover wraps in an airtight container in the fridge. They are best consumed within 1-2 days.
